#e41538 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e41538 is composed of 89.4% red, 8.2%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 90.8% magenta, 75.4%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 349.9 degrees, a saturation of 83.1% and a lightness of 48.8%. #e41538 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2a70 with #c90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

#e41538 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e41538 has RGB values of R:228, G:21,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.91, Y:0.75,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14947640.

Shades and Tints of #e41538
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0103 is the darkest color, while #fefafa is the lightest one.
